Output 695e18f70320234f4f250ad0fe04558d67b28b82bfab89a2d0bb9177f7fbdb40:2

value
19136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838dc06cc30a03d751c88c701a7f63dab135c11f OP_EQUAL
address
3DgcFkYLf5Gs3hSmbnhyVSb626VVa9oB92
transaction
695e18f70320234f4f250ad0fe04558d67b28b82bfab89a2d0bb9177f7fbdb40
spent
true